I am raising yet again the issue of homecare packages. Three weeks ago I referred to the plight of an 18 year old girl, Hannah Donnelly from Drogheda who has been in hospital for over two and a half years. For the last 19 months she has been in hospital because she has been denied an adequate homecare package. It is three weeks since I raised the case and I have written to the Minister for Health, Deputy Harris, and the Minister of State, Deputy Finian McGrath, about it. It appears that neither of them has intervened to secure Hannah's homecare package. At this stage I am wondering. She is 18 years of age and has been waiting for 19 months for a homecare package. She is desperate to get home and her parents are desperate to have her home. Is it that the Minister simply does not care enough? Why has he not looked into the case?
